- 浏览: 810013 次
- 性别:
- 来自: 淄博
-
最新评论
-
xinglianxlxl:
对我有用,谢谢
Spring 定时任务之 @Scheduled cron表达式 -
cb_2017:
...
Spring 定时任务之 @Scheduled cron表达式 -
a251628111:
谢谢分享
Spring 定时任务之 @Scheduled cron表达式 -
hl174:
确实是这个问题 不知道谁把数据库改了
java.lang.IllegalArgumentException: Timestamp format must be yyyy-mm-dd hh:mm:ss -
gotosuzhou:
zhangzi 写道lylshr 写道顶,大哥你真强啊晕死,这 ...
数据库是SQLServer2008,出现'limit' 附近有语法错误
相关推荐
- Save/SaveOrUpdate:将对象插入或更新到数据库。 - Get:根据ID从数据库中获取对象。 - Load:延迟加载,返回对象的代理,直到访问其属性时才实际执行查询。 - Update/Flush:更新对象并提交到数据库。 - ...
4. **批量保存到数据库**:使用Hibernate的`Session`对象,通过`saveOrUpdate`或`batchUpdate`方法批量保存数据。 5. **错误处理**:捕获并处理可能出现的异常,记录日志。 示例代码可能如下: ```java public ...
1. 持久化(Persistence):通过Session的save()或saveOrUpdate()方法将对象保存到数据库。 2. 加载(Loading):利用Session的get()或load()方法从数据库加载对象。 3. 更新(Update):调用Session的update()方法...
- 更新:使用Session的update()或saveOrUpdate()方法。 - 删除:使用Session的delete()方法。 - 查询:使用Session的get()、load()或Criteria API,或HQL(Hibernate Query Language)进行复杂查询。 4. **事务...
- **Create(创建)**:通过Session的`save()`或`saveOrUpdate()`方法将对象持久化到数据库。 - **Read(读取)**:使用`get()`或`load()`方法根据主键获取对象,或者使用`createQuery()`或`createCriteria()`进行...
- `saveOrUpdate()`: 根据对象状态决定执行`save()`或`update()`。 - `lock()`: 不做任何更新,仅用于确保对象在内存中的状态与数据库同步。 **四、Session加载实体对象的过程** 1. **一级缓存检查**: Session首先...